I hope by "0" you're referring to a Linux kernel defined software value and _not_ what the HW or BIOS conjured up! Case in point: I was involved a while ago in tracking down and fixing a local APIC enumeration bug in the x86-32 (i386) kernel code, where the kernel failed miserably on some dual K7 boxes because (a) only one CPU socket was populated, (b) the BIOS assigned that CPU a non-zero ID, and (c) the kernel (apic.c) had a bug which triggered when BSP ID != 0.
